On Hit the Spot May 18, 2024
Title Hit the Spot
Even after reading the reviews here, I wasn't prepared for how explivit this show would be - I mean, for a show in SK? It's just wild. But in a good way!
It could def be better, but for what it is, it was pretty good! Especially Hee Jae's and the psychologist's plot was pretty nice. (Although her encouraging him to enter the relationship with her could be perceived as icky if roles were reversed...). The 2FL's plot was a bit too shallow for my liking and didn't get enough screentime. But for a short series, my heart still skipped a bit more than one time. Recommended if you want something more than the vanilla from most kdramas, where 30 yo act like they are shy teenagers when it comes to sex.

On Salon De Nabi May 14, 2024
Imo, Salon de Nabi has the same problem that most medical dramas have - while the focus on patients - and here, customers - brings a nice perspective, there are just too many characters and plots. You will most probably feel that your favourites didn't get enough screentime when you finish the drama - even the main leads. I was pretty frustrated tbh. I mean, even the hairdressers and interns were a crowd already, and add the customers - there is simply not enough time for all of them.
Let me tell you, I am a sucker for romance. And it had soo much potential here - but there was just too little screentime. Don't get me wrong, it was still pretty special and different from the usual romance dramas - but there could have been so much more. When the main couple got together, I honestly had butterflies in my stomach, and awaited what's to come for them - but let me tell you, it's not much. In the first few eps their pace was soo fast, faster than in other dramas - and then it basically stopped, leaving some plots unresolved.
But the drama is still very good nevertheless. It has some of the most realistic characters I've seen in a while - they are not one -dimensional caricatoures just for comedy sake. I'm just sad that just a bit more time for main characters would make a huge difference.
